At least 20 people have died after an Air Force plane crashed into a school in Bangladesh.
More than 170 have been rescued with many of those killed feared to be students when the training aircraft smashed in into a campus in the capital of Dhaka.
The crash occurred shortly after takeoff on Monday afternoon, engulfing the building in flames and killing the pilot.
